AD584JNZ Details

  • Manufacturer Part Number:

    AD584JNZ

  • Brand Name:

    Analog Devices Inc

  • Pbfree Code:

    No

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Part Package Code:

    DIP

  • Package Description:

    PLASTIC, DIP-8

  • Pin Count:

    8

  • Manufacturer Package Code:

    N-8

  • Country Of Origin:

    Philippines

  • ECCN Code:

    EAR99

  • HTS Code:

    8542.39.00.01

  • Manufacturer:

    Analog Devices Inc

  • YTEOL:

    10

  • Additional Feature:

    ADDITIONAL PROGRAMMABLE OUTPUTS OF 7.5V, 5V, 2.5V AVAILABLE

  • Analog IC - Other Type:

    THREE TERMINAL VOLTAGE REFERENCE

  • JESD-30 Code:

    R-PDIP-T8

  • JESD-609 Code:

    e3

  • Length:

    9.88 mm

  • Number of Functions:

    1

  • Number of Outputs:

    1

  • Number of Terminals:

    8

  • Operating Temperature-Max:

    70 °C

  • Output Voltage-Max:

    10.03 V

  • Output Voltage-Min:

    9.97 V

  • Output Voltage-Nom:

    10 V

  • Package Body Material:

    PLASTIC/EPOXY

  • Package Code:

    DIP

  • Package Equivalence Code:

    DIP8,.3

  • Package Shape:

    RECTANGULAR

  • Package Style:

    IN-LINE

  • Qualification Status:

    Not Qualified

  • Seated Height-Max:

    5.33 mm

  • Supply Current-Max (Isup):

    1 mA

  • Supply Voltage-Max (Vsup):

    30 V

  • Supply Voltage-Min (Vsup):

    4.5 V

  • Supply Voltage-Nom (Vsup):

    15 V

  • Surface Mount:

    NO

  • Technology:

    BIPOLAR

  • Temp Coef of Voltage-Max:

    30 ppm/°C

  • Temperature Grade:

    COMMERCIAL

  • Terminal Finish:

    Matte Tin (Sn)

  • Terminal Form:

    THROUGH-HOLE

  • Terminal Pitch:

    2.54 mm

  • Terminal Position:

    DUAL

  • Trim/Adjustable Output:

    YES

  • Voltage Tolerance-Max:

    0.3%

  • Width:

    7.62 mm

About Analog Devices

Analog Devices Inc. is a global leader in the design and manufacturing of analog, mixed-signal, and digital signal processing integrated circuits and software solutions for the industrial, automotive, healthcare, communications industries. Analog Devices serves a diverse range of markets including industrial, automotive, healthcare, energy, aerospace, defense, and consumer electronics industries. Analog Devices’ product portfolio includes a wide range of ICs, modules, and subsystems.
